On 5/19/2012 7:44 PM, Don Hill AA5AU wrote:
> If anyone has contact with any of the support team for XX9E or direct contact 
> with the team, please tell them we appreciate their
> RTTY effort, but if they could please change their RTTY message to something 
> like:
>
> CALLSIGN CALLSIGN 599 CALLSIGN
>
> This morning they were using:
>
> CALLSIGN 599
>
> or
>
> CALLSIGN CALLSIGN 599
>
> It was very difficult to tell who they were coming back to this morning on 30 
> meter because they were very weak and when they
> started to transmit, it took some time for the decoders to work and get 
> sync'd. Hopefully they'll try 17 RTTY in the USA morning
> because that band was open longpath (30 was not real good longpath to them).
>
> IT WOULD BE BETTER FOR EVERYONE IF THEY PUT THE CALLSIGN OF THE STATION THEY 
> ARE WORKING AT THE END OF THE EXCHANGE.
